The following information is to be used for the next two questions. Molar absorptivity data for the cobalt and nickel complexes with 2,3-quinoxalinedithiol are ?Co = 36400 and ?Ni = 5520 at 510 nm and ?Co = 1240 and ? Ni = 17500 at 656 nm. A 0.499-g sample was dissolved and diluted to 100.0 mL. A 25.0-mL aliquot was treated to eliminate interferences; after addition of 2,3-quinoxalinedithiol, the volume was adjusted to 50.0 mL. This solution had an absorbance of 0.810 at 510 nm and 0.476 at 656 nm in a 1.00-cm cell. a) Calculate the concentration of cobalt (in ppm) in the initial solution prepared by dissolving the sample. b)Calculate the concentration of nickel (in ppm) in the initial solution prepared by dissolving the sample.
